27 PLAYERS SELECTED IN THE FIRST CFL LFA DRAFT IN MEXICO CITY

By Lucas Barrett Manager, Communications & Public Affairs, Canadian Football League

DIEGO JAIR VIAMONTES SELECTED FIRST OVERALL BY EDMONTON

Monday, January 14, 2019 — Monday, January 14, 2019 — MEXICO CITY – Following a combine in Mexico hosted by Mexico’s Liga de Futbol Americano Profesional (LFA), the LFA and the Canadian Football League (CFL) conducted a three-round draft in Mexico City’s Crowne Plaza Hotel that saw CFL teams select 27 players from the LFA.With the first overall pick, Edmonton selected wide receiver Diego Jair Viamontes, who plays for the Mexico City Mayas.

First overall pick Diego Jair Viamontes said the following after his selection: “I met with many coaches of all the teams but with the Edmonton coaches I was really chatting about football, about why I love to play, what was my biggest dream and I felt a connection. I’m very grateful for today. I’m very thankful for the organization of the Edmonton Eskimos for putting this trust in me. They won’t regret it.”

Prior to the 106th Grey Cup presented by Shaw last year in Edmonton, the CFL and LFA signed a letter of intent that will see them work together on several projects including possible CFL games in Mexico.

CFL teams are scheduled to open their training camps for the 2019 season on Sunday, May 19. The season begins on Thursday June 13 when the Saskatchewan Roughriders face off against the Hamilton Tiger-Cats. Edmonton will host Montreal on Friday June 14 and the Calgary Stampeders will launch the defense of their championship on Saturday June 15 when they host the Ottawa REDBLACKS. Opening week wraps up with the Winnipeg Blue Bombers travelling to BC to play the Lions.

The 107th Grey Cup presented by Shaw will be played at McMahon Stadium in Calgary on Sunday November 24 at 6 p.m. ET (4 p.m. local time).
